Why a Batched Cocktail Is the Smartest Move You’ll Make This Weekend
No party host wants to play bartender all afternoon. When you’ve got guests to greet, burgers to flip and a lawn chair with your name on it, spending your afternoon behind the bar isn’t the move.
That’s the beauty of a batched cocktail. Mix everything in a pitcher the night before, stick it in the fridge, and by the time your first guests arrive, you’ve already got drinks covered. No measuring, no muddling, no mess — just pour over ice and enjoy.
This recipe makes eight generous servings from a single pitcher. Have a bigger crowd? Keep the proportions and scale it up, and you’re golden.
Why Blueberry Bourbon Lemonade Is the Best Memorial Day Weekend Batched Cocktail
A lot of batched cocktails fall flat — too watered down, too one-note or just forgettable. This one is none of those things.
The backbone is good bourbon, balanced against the brightness of fresh-squeezed lemon juice and deepened by a gorgeous blueberry simple syrup made from scratch. The result is something that hits sweet, tart, a little boozy and deeply refreshing — all at once.

The color alone draws eyes. That deep violet-purple hue looks refreshing and delicious, and it comes from the homemade blueberry syrup, which takes a few extra minutes to make but makes the whole thing taste more special and handcrafted than anything you’d pour from a bottle.
Garnish with lemon wheels, a handful of fresh blueberries or a sprig of mint — or all three, if you want to really jazz it up.
